Job overview

For September 2023, we are looking to appoint a Graduate Music Assistant to assist the general day-to-day running of the Music Department, including supporting academic lessons, individual student support, and assisting with our extensive co-curricular programme. The successful candidate will have a degree in Music, specialism in one or more musical instruments, and experience in performing as a soloist and in ensembles. This is a full-time post, term time only, for a fixed term of one academic year.

Single accommodation may be available; if accommodation is included, there would be the expectation of additional duties in one of the school’s boarding houses.
